Middle Ages: The High Middle Ages Enter your search terms: While some independence from feudal rule was gained by the rising towns (see commune , in medieval history), their system of guilds perpetuated the Christian and medieval spirit of economic life, which stressed the collective entity, disapproved of unregulated competition, and minimized the profit motive. This age marked the end of Viking expansion with the Norman conquest of England in 1066 and the beginning of major religious upheaval between various monotheistic kingdoms starting with the Great Schism between the western Roman Catholic Church and eastern Greek Orthodox Church in 1054. The period was marked by economic and territorial expansion, demographic and urban growth, the emergence of national identity, and the restructuring of secular and ecclesiastical institutions.
